Trading Questions

You can buy as few as 1 share. Check individual market details for any minimum order requirements.
Yes, you can cancel any open order from the Orders page. Once an order is filled, it cannot be cancelled. Funds are immediately returned when you cancel.
It depends on market liquidity. Some orders fill instantly if there’s a matching order; others may take time. You can always cancel open orders if needed.
Your order stays in the order book until it fills or you cancel it. You can cancel and place a new order at a different price.
You can cancel any open order and place a new one. Once filled, orders cannot be changed.
Limit orders let you set a specific price — they may not fill immediately. Market orders fill instantly at the current price, guaranteeing execution.

Market Questions

Markets resolve based on their specific resolution criteria. Some resolve automatically using tracked data (e.g. sports scores, stock prices); others are resolved by admins based on the market’s stated criteria.
After a market settles, payouts are processed automatically to winners. This usually happens shortly after the market resolves.
You can create markets, but they must be approved first. Markets need clear questions, specific resolution criteria, and appropriate expiration dates. Some topics may be prohibited.
Usually 24–48 hours, but may vary depending on volume and complexity. You’ll be notified when your market is reviewed.
No, markets cannot be edited once approved. Make sure all information is correct before submitting. Contact support if critical changes are needed.
If a market is cancelled, all orders are refunded and no payouts are made. Your funds are returned to your account.

Payment Questions

Predicta supports Paystack (card & mobile money), cryptocurrency via NowPayments, SWIFT bank transfer, INMBank, and M-Pesa. Available methods may vary by region.
  • Paystack / M-Pesa: Instant after confirmation
  • Cryptocurrency: A few minutes after blockchain confirmation
  • SWIFT: 1–5 business days
  • INMBank: Varies by method
Predicta does not charge deposit fees, but your payment provider may have their own fees. Check with your provider before depositing.
Usually 1–3 business days depending on the withdrawal method.
Some withdrawal methods may have fees, which are deducted from the withdrawal amount. Check the details when setting up your withdrawal method.
No, you can only withdraw available funds. Funds in suspense are reserved for open orders. Cancel orders to free them up.

Portfolio Questions

Go to the “Portfolios” page in the sidebar. You’ll see all markets where you have positions, with your holdings and current values. Click any row to expand and see position details.
Your portfolio shows profit/loss for each position. It’s calculated as: (Current Price × Shares) − (What You Paid). Positive = profit, negative = unrealised loss.
Yes — go to the “Trades” page to see all completed trades. The “Orders” page shows your full order history.
Sell all your shares in that market. Go to the market page or your portfolio, click “Sell”, enter the quantity, and confirm.
